Job Description
Primary Responsibilities: The Financial Analyst is primarily responsible for building and maintaining various financial models for cashflow projections, valuation, and ad hoc analyses related to fund and corporate financial performance. The position is a great opportunity to learn about single-family rental (SFR) and build-for-rent (BFR) real estate in a fast-paced and collaborative environment.

Essential Job Functions:
Portfolio and Corporate Financial Modelling
Maintain and build various in-house real estate cashflow models to evaluate and forecast investment performance at fund and/or market level for single-family rental and build-for-rent assets
Assist with G&A forecast
Assist with fund performance analytics and exit strategy by providing return and sensitivity analyses
Enhance existing Excel-based financial models using R or VBA automation
Extract source data via SQL query from various data sources
Other duties, as assigned by supervisor or leadership team.
Valuation
Prepare routine fund portfolio valuation report using discounted cashflow, cost basis, and direct capitalization methods
Maintain and build in-house valuation models for recurring investor reporting and Board of Directors presentations
Keep track of residential home pricing and cap rate trends by sector and market to align model assumptions with external valuation partners
Maintain collaborative and productive relationship with third-party asset valuation partners for routine fair market value reporting
Industry Research & Benchmarking
Monitor key sector and industry indicators, supply and demand, macroeconomic metrics at national and MSA-level
Benchmark platform performance with SFR/BFR industry key players
